Whenever I visit the loo, I get a slight burning sensation when I pass motions in the anal region mostly the opening. This has been happening from the past 2-3 weeks I guess. I suffered from stomach infection/ food poisoning recently. I also have constipation problem by birth. There is no excruciating pain or hard pain just a slight burning like feeling something that usually happens when we eat very spicy food the day before. Can it be piles/haemorrhoids? Please suggest medication also. Are there any home remedies to this condition?
